Default Wanting to get rid of cat-back duals

I'm looking to get rid of the cat-back dual setup I have with the Magnaflow that's on the truck.

I'm thinking about going with a Corsa or another Magnaflow single in-singe out.


Right now, it's a single in then dual 2-1/2" out the back.

I don't want to dump it under the cab or before the axle.

My thought is this:

Run the stock Y-pipe to the new muffler then run a single 3" pipe out the back and dump it at an angle (similar to stock) with a single 4" slant cut tip or rolled tip.


Does that sound like a decent plan?
